  • a 'true' six pointer is when the teams are three points apart. hence a positive result can render the teams level one way or six points adrift the other. the term isn't prerequisite on a relegation contest either. i've seen the term applied to teams 11 pts apart (!) and even once , by lineker, on the first day of the season (?). theoretically every game is a six pointer so it's the difference that is important.
